โ€ข Introduction to Hybrid Electric Systems: Fundamentals of hybrid electric systems, types of hybrid systems, and their advantages

โ€ข Power Electronics: Basics of power electronics, power electronic converters, and their applications in hybrid electric systems

โ€ข Energy Storage Technologies: Overview of battery technologies, ultracapacitors, and fuel cells for hybrid electric systems

โ€ข Electric Machines: Types of electric machines, their construction, and working principles in hybrid electric systemsโ€ข System Design and Optimization: Methods for system design and optimization, including trade-off analysis and modeling

โ€ข Control Strategies: Energy management, power distribution, and control algorithms for hybrid electric systems

โ€ข Regulations and Standards: Overview of regulations, standards, and policies governing the design and implementation of hybrid electric systems

โ€ข Market Analysis and Trends: Market analysis and trends for hybrid electric systems, including opportunities and challenges

โ€ข Sustainability and Environmental Impact: Sustainability and environmental impact assessment of hybrid electric systems
